Merrimack is pleased to offer Graduate Fellowship opportunities. Fellowships are highly competitive programs that link graduate study with an on-site professional experience, building and enhancing your professional skills. Fellows graduate in one year with a Master’s degree. The fellowship offers reduced tuition costs.

The application period is now open for the following fellowship programs:

Education

Offering full-tuition fellowships in each of these M.Ed. programs:

  • Community Engagement
  • Higher Education
  • Teacher Education

Learn More 

Health Sciences

Offering reduced-tuition fellowships in each of these M.S. programs:

  • Community Health Education
  • Exercise and Sport Science
  • Health and Wellness Management
